Grumman G44A N213K
5 November 1968 · Piseco Lake, New York, United States · No injuries
Summary
On 5 November 1968 at about 16:20 local time, a Grumman G44A registered N213K, operated by Knox Gelatine, was involved in an accident during the landing phase of flight near Piseco Lake, New York, United States. 2 people were on board and nobody was injured. The aircraft was substantially damaged. No probable cause statement is available for this record.
